Plot Summary

Set against the backdrop of the Volga region, this silent film explores the lives and struggles of the local peasantry. It delves into themes of tradition, hardship, and the impact of societal changes on rural communities. The narrative follows the intertwined destinies of several characters as they navigate their challenging existence.
